3(1)+2(_)=6<br><br> plz help on filling in the blank
TEA [102]

Answer:

x = 3/2

Step-by-step explanation:

Let's solve your equation step-by-step.

(3)(1)+2x=6

Step 1: Simplify both sides of the equation.

(3)(1)+2x=6

3+2x=6

2x+3=6

Step 2: Subtract 3 from both sides.

2x+3−3=6−3

2x=3

Step 3: Divide both sides by 2.

2x/2  3/2

x = 3/2

How many people will 5 pitchers serve if pitcher serves 1/8 one person?
Marianna [84]
So if a person has 1/8 of a pitcher then you have 8 people per pitcher. Then if you have 5 pitchers you do 5 x 8 and get 40 so 40 people will be served. Hope this helps :)
